4Recruitment Services are seeking a compassionate and committed Family Support Worker to work for our client based in Worcester. This is a rewarding opportunity to support children, young people and families to build stability, resilience and brighter futures. If you are passionate about helping others, confident in working with families facing complex challenges, and able to build trusting relationships, we would love to hear from you.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ES INCLUDE:
- Work directly with families in their homes and communities
- Provide practical and emotional support tailored to individual needs
- Help parents develop skills and confidence
- Safeguard and promote the welfare of children and young people
- Work in partnership with schools, social workers and other professionals
- Keep clear, accurate records and contribute to support plans
ESSENTIAL REQUIREMENTS INCLUDE:
- Experience working with children, young people or families
- Strong communication and listening skills
- A calm, empathetic and non-judgemental approach
- Ability to manage challenging situations professionally
- Good organisational and time management skills
- A relevant qualification or willingness to work towards one
- Enhanced DBS check
